E E 461A - Digital Systems and Computer Design

Prereq: E E 352. Computer organization and architecture with emphasis in design of superscalar processors and advanced architectures; pipelined fixed and floating-point data-path design; RISC vs. CISC and hard-wired vs. micro-programmed control organizations; memory hierarchy and memory management; I/O units and interfacing; operating system support vector and array-processing; sharedmemory multiprocessing; distributed and grid computing; multi-threaded processors; system modeling and performance measurement; futuristic man-machine interface and display systems. A term paper is required and a design/computer project is assigned involving hardware design and system simulation. May be retaken two times excluding withdrawals, but only last course taken counts.
